当前位置:首页> 传奇私服> 传奇私服DBC数据库添加装备问题

传奇私服DBC数据库添加装备问题

传奇私服游戏中,装备是玩家提升实力的重要手段之一。为了满足玩家的需求,很多游戏开发者会在游戏中添加各种装备,包括武器、防具、道具等。而在游戏中添加装备的过程需要涉及到数据库的交互,以便将装备数据存储到数据库中,并在游戏中展示和交易。本文将介绍如何在传奇私服游戏中使用DBC数据库添加装备的问题。

装备数据结构设计

在添加装备之前,我们需要设计好装备的数据结构。通常,装备数据包括以下字段:

装备名称:用于标识不同的装备。
   装备类型:包括武器、防具、道具等。
   品质:分为普通、稀有、史诗、传奇等不同等级。
   属性:包括攻击力、防御力、魔法防御等不同属性。
   附加效果:包括特殊技能、增益效果等。
   获得方式:描述玩家获得装备的方式。
   交易价格:表示装备的交易价值。

根据这些字段,我们可以将装备数据存储到数据库中,以便在游戏中展示和交易。

添加装备到数据库

在传奇私服游戏中,玩家可以通过各种方式获得装备,如任务奖励、副本掉落、交易等。为了将这些装备数据存储到数据库中,我们需要编写相应的代码,将装备数据插入到数据库中。具体实现过程如下:

1. 根据装备数据结构编写相应的实体类,包括装备名称、类型、品质、属性、附加效果、获得方式、交易价格等属性。
  2. 使用Java等编程语言编写相应的DAO(数据访问对象)类,实现与数据库的交互,包括创建数据库连接、执行插入语句等操作。
  3. 在玩家获得装备时,调用相应的DAO类,将装备数据插入到数据库中。具体实现时需要指定玩家的角色ID和装备信息,以及相关的SQL语句和参数。
  4. 确保在数据库中成功插入相应的数据后,可以在游戏中展示和交易该装备。

装备查询和展示

在游戏中展示和交易装备时,需要从数据库中查询相应的数据并展示给玩家。具体实现过程如下:

1. 在DAO类中编写相应的查询语句和参数,根据玩家角色ID和装备信息查询相应的装备数据。
  2. 将查询结果封装为相应的实体类对象或JSON字符串,返回给游戏客户端。
  3. 在游戏客户端中展示和交易该装备,包括显示装备名称、类型、品质、属性等信息,并提供玩家之间交易的功能。

需要注意的是,在查询和展示装备时,需要保证数据的安全性和准确性。为了防止恶意玩家盗取其他玩家的装备,需要对登录账号进行权限控制和加密处理。

优化问题与
  在传奇私服游戏中添加装备是一个复杂而繁琐的过程,需要考虑多方面的因素和细节问题。在实践中需要注意以下几点:

1. 确保数据库的安全性和稳定性,避免出现数据丢失或损坏的情况。
  2. 合理设计数据库表结构和字段类型,提高查询和展示的效率。
  3. 优化代码逻辑和性能,减少不必要的资源消耗和延迟。
  4. 及时更新和维护游戏系统和数据库,确保游戏的稳定性和可靠性。

在传奇私服游戏中添加装备是一个重要的功能之一,需要游戏开发者认真考虑和规划。通过合理设计数据结构、编写相应的代码和优化系统性能,可以为用户提供更好的游戏体验和交易平台。